Restrictions on fishing and new marine protection areas are being introduced to protect Auckland's Hauraki Gulf.
Gulf X is a major marine restoration project launched by The Sustainable Business Network in 2019.
GulfX works with businesses to, among other things, reduce marine plastic pollution and cut transport pollution through promoting copper-free brake pads to cut down on heavy metals in storm water polluting the Gulf.
Sustainable Business Network CEO Rachel Brown told Kerre McIvor protecting our marine environments is more than just about fisheries.
“A real problem that we still haven’t solved is sediment, that’s the stuff we’ve been trying to look at… it sits in the harbour and makes that regeneration of fish stocks and mussels really slow.”
